| Uwajima vs Majuro Climate & Distance Between | |
- The distance between Uwajima, Japan and Majuro, Marshall Islands is approximately 4,940 km or 3,070 mi.
- To reach Uwajima in this distance one would set out from Majuro bearing 311.5°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Uwajima bearing 297.2° or WNW .
- Uwajima has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Majuro has a tropical rainforest climate (Af).
- The mean annual temperature is 11.3 °C (20.3°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 20.4 °C (36.7°F) more in Uwajima. The continentality subtype is semicontinental as opposed to extremely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1700.8 mm (67 in) less which is equivalent to 1700.8 l/m² (41.74 US gal/ft²) or 17,008,000 l/ha (1,818,268 US gal/ac) less. About 1/2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 17.4° lower in Uwajima than in Majuro.
